Marlene A. Parker Obituary

It is with deep sorrow that we announce the death of Marlene A. Parker in Livingston, Montana, who passed away on September 22, 2025, at the age of 79, leaving to mourn family and friends. She was predeceased by: her father Clarence Ayers; her siblings, Terry, Rich Ayers and Tina Ingram; and her daughter Jennifer Relaford.

She is survived by: her mother Joy Adams; her husband Fred Parker of Livingston; and her sons, Mick Stockwell (Kari) of Mountain Home, ID, Chris Stockwell (Liz) of Santa Clarita, CA and Terry Parker of Livingston. She is also survived by 15 grandchildren and six great-grandchildren.

Donations may be made in her memory to Stafford Animal Shelter in Livingston.
